And Keras for Ubuntu 20.04 is a High-level Neural Networks API, written in Python and capable of Running on Top of TensorFlow, CNTK, or Theano.

It was Developed with a focus on enabling Fast Experimentation. Being able to go from Idea to Result with the least possible Delay is key to doing Good Research.

Before installing Keras, please install one of its backend engines: TensorFlow, Theano, or CNTK. Here is shown How to Install Recommended TensorFlow backend.
